Their quantities have been smaller than in all kinds of other eastern towns mostly since most had uncovered production Careers at General Electric powered in Schenectady.[148] The Jewish Neighborhood were proven early, with Sephardic Jewish members as Component of the Beverwijck Neighborhood. Its population rose through the late nineteenth century, when a lot of Ashkenazi Jews immigrated from eastern Europe.[148] In that interval, there was also an influx of Chinese and east Asian immigrants, who settled during the downtown area of the city. Many of their descendants have since moved to suburban regions.[149] Asian immigration all but halted after the Immigration Act of 1924.[one hundred fifty]

From the late 18th century and during the majority of the nineteenth, Albany was a Middle of trade and transportation. The city lies towards the north stop of the navigable Hudson River. It absolutely was the initial eastern terminus of your Erie Canal, connecting to The good Lakes, and was house to a lot of the earliest railroads on this planet. Correct numbers on spiritual denominations in Albany aren't available. Demographic statistics in The usa depend greatly on America Census Bureau, which are not able to ask about religious affiliation as Element of its decennial census.[170] It does compile some countrywide and statewide religious stats,[171] but these are definitely not representative of the town the size of Albany.
